What Is 'Christmas Tree Syndrome'?

December 14, 2023

Whenever Maggie Mundwiller is around holiday decorations for about five minutes, she breaks out in an itchy rash and worse. Many are taking to social media to document their problems with Christmas trees. Allergist Dr. Zachary Rubin says “It's estimated that maybe as high as about seven to ten percent of people who are around Christmas trees, whether they're real or fake, will have increased allergy or asthma symptoms.”
